Role Overview
The Chemist will be responsible for process development, optimization, and scale-up of specialty chemical molecules from lab to pilot/plant scale. The role requires strong technical expertise, documentation rigor, and collaboration with cross-functional and manufacturing teams.
Key Responsibilities
Develop and optimize synthetic routes for target molecules
Execute lab-scale reactions and ensure reproducibility
Conduct process optimization (yield improvement, cost reduction, impurity control)
Support technology transfer from R&D to plant scale
Maintain accurate documentation (BMR, SOPs, lab notebooks)
Perform analytical interpretation (HPLC, GC, NMR, etc.)
Troubleshoot process challenges during scale-up
Coordinate with plant teams, QA/QC, and project managers
Ensure compliance with safety and regulatory standards
Required Competencies
M.Sc. in Organic Chemistry / Industrial Chemistry / Pharmaceutical Chemistry
2–6 years of experience in CDMO / CRO / Specialty Chemicals / API manufacturing
Strong understanding of reaction mechanisms and process chemistry
Experience in scale-up and tech transfer is preferred
Knowledge of analytical techniques (HPLC, GC, NMR, IR)
Good documentation and communication skills
